A Spotify MP3 Downloader is a tool that allows users to convert Spotify tracks into MP3 format. While Spotify Premium offers an offline feature, it keeps the music locked within the app, meaning you can't transfer or save those songs as MP3 files on your device. A Spotify MP3 Downloader removes this limitation, giving you full access to your music in a universal file format.

Using these tools is a straightforward process. Here's an essential guide:
1. Find a Reliable Downloader: Find a reputable Spotify MP3 Downloader or Album Downloader online. Many tools offer browser-based or software options, but always ensure the tool is safe and virus-free.
2. Copy the Spotify Link: Open Spotify and find the track, album, or playlist you want to download. Right-click on the song, album, or playlist, and select "Copy Link."
3. Paste the Link: Open the downloader tool and paste the copied Spotify link into the provided field.
4. Start the Download: Click the "Download" or "Convert" button, and the tool will convert the tracks or albums into MP3 files.
5. Enjoy Your Music: Once the download is complete, transfer the MP3 files to any device or media player, and enjoy your Spotify music offline, anytime.
